Front Panel Features
The VXI-MXI-2 has the following front panel features:
Three front panel LEDs
SYSFAIL LED indicates that the VMEbus SYSFAIL line is
asserted.
MXI LED indicates when the VXI-MXI-2 is accessed from the
MXIbus.
VXI LED indicates when the VXI-MXI-2 is accessed from the
VXIbus.
MXIbus connector
Three SMB connectors
External clock
Trigger output
Trigger input
System reset pushbutton
Removing the Metal Enclosure
The VXI-MXI-2 is housed in a metal enclosure to improve EMC
performance and to provide easy handling. Because the enclosure includes
cutouts to facilitate changes to the switch and jumper settings, it should not
be necessary to remove it under normal circumstances.
However, it is necessary to remove the enclosure if you want to change
the amount of DRAM installed on the VXI-MXI-2. Switch S6, which is
directly related to the amount of DRAM you want to install, is also
accessible only by removing the enclosure. If you will be making this
change, remove the four screws on the top, the four screws on the bottom,
and the five screws on the right side cover of the enclosure. Refer to the
Onboard DRAM section for details about changing DRAM.
